Terras de Cavaleiros Geopark: A UNESCO Global Geopark [PDF]

open access: yes, 2020
The Terras de Cavaleiros Geopark (TCG), a UNESCO Global Geopark, is located in Northern Portugal and is established on rare and unique geological, scenic, ecological and cultural values. The most significant geological value is related to the most complete sequence of Pre-Mesozoic allochthonous geological units in NW Iberia.

Volcanic Monument of Western Anatolia: Kula-Salihli UNESCO Global Geopark [PDF]

open access: yesGeoconservation Research, 2023
The Kula-Salihli UNESCO Global Geopark includes evidence of geological history spanning 600 million years, from Palaeozoic metamorphic rocks to late prehistoric volcanic eruptions.

Palaeontological And Geological Highlights Of The Black Country UNESCO Global Geopark [PDF]

open access: yesGeoconservation Research, 2021
The Black Country UNESCO Global Geopark, located in central England, joined the Global Geopark Network in July 2020. It is the most urban Geopark in the network with a population of approximately 1.1 million people.
